The Significance of Historic Windows
In the context of architectural history, windows are more than just functional openings for light and air. They reflect the technological capabilities and artistic patterns of their age. From the thick, hand-blown glass of the Georgian duration to the intricate leaded lights of the Victorian age, every detail tells a story.
Generic contemporary replacements typically stop working to catch the subtle nuances of historic windows. Mass-produced timber or uPVC frames lack the slender profiles and authentic joinery of initial windows, typically leading to a "flat" appearance that lessens the home's heritage value. This is where specialists step in, focusing on preservation instead of simple replacement.
Remediation vs. Replacement: A Comprehensive Comparison
Choosing whether to restore an original window or change it totally is one of the most substantial difficulties for home owners. Professionals generally promote for restoration due to the remarkable quality of "old-growth" timber found in historic frames, which is frequently more long lasting than contemporary equivalents.
The following table describes the key distinctions in between remediation and replacement in a historic context:
| Aspect | Window Restoration | Period-Accurate Replacement |
|---|---|---|
| Product Authenticity | Protects original old-growth lumber and glass. | Utilizes new wood, typically Accoya or woods. |
| Planning Permission | Usually favored by preservation officers. | May need strict approval and in-depth drawings. |
| Thermal Performance | Improved via draught-proofing and secondary glazing. | Can consist of slim-profile double glazing. |
| Expense | Can be labor-intensive however avoids structural modifications. | High preliminary cost for bespoke joinery. |
| Longevity | Can last another 100+ years with upkeep. | High, especially if using modified woods. |
| Ecological Impact | Low (minimal waste, carbon stays sequestered). | Moderate (manufacturing and disposal of old units). |
Navigating Regulatory Frameworks
For owners of listed structures or homes situated within sanctuary, the legal structure surrounding window alterations is strict. Historic home window specialists should be fluent in regional and nationwide planning policies.
In many jurisdictions, changing initial windows with contemporary double glazing is restricted because it modifies the profile and reflection of the structure. Specialists work closely with preservation officers to propose services-- such as "Slimlite" glazing or discreet draught-proofing-- that satisfy both the desire for convenience and the legal requirement for conservation.

Technical Innovations in Restoration
The main objective of a window expert is to improve a window's functionality without changing its appearance. This is attained through numerous specialized methods.
Lumber Repair and Resin Stabilization
Rather than replacing a decomposing windowsill, experts use "splicing" (getting rid of only the damaged area and fitting brand-new, seasoned wood) or innovative epoxy resins. These resins can stabilize soft, rotting wood, bonding with the initial fibers to develop a structural repair work that is essentially unnoticeable once painted.
Draught-Proofing Systems
Among the most significant grievances relating to historical windows is heat loss and rattling. Specialists install boundary sealing systems. These include machining a little groove into the window beads or the sashes themselves and placing a brush or silicone seal. This substantially lowers air infiltration while remaining unnoticeable when the window is closed.
Expert Glazing
Traditional double glazing is typically too thick (20mm+) for historical rebates. Experts utilize "slim-profile" vacuum glazing or gas-filled systems that are as thin as 6mm or 10mm. These systems offer thermal insulation comparable to modern windows while fitting into the original thin glazing bars.
Modern Upgrades for Historic Windows
For lots of, the aim is to attain contemporary energy ratings without sacrificing the soul of the structure. The table below highlights how professionals integrate contemporary innovation into heritage frames.
| Upgrade Type | Methodology | Benefit |
|---|---|---|
| Vacuum Glazing | Two layers of glass with a vacuum in between. | Supplies U-values comparable to triple glazing at 6mm density. |
| Acoustic Glass | Laminated glass developed to moisten noise. | Minimizes street noise by up to 40dB without changing the frame. |
| Accoya Timber | Acetylated wood that does not swell or shrink. | Perfect for replacement elements as it withstands rot and movement. |
| Weighted Rebalancing | Recalculating lead weights after including heavier glass. | Guarantees smooth operation of sash windows no matter glass weight. |

Often Asked Questions (FAQ)
Can historical windows be double-glazed?
In many cases, yes. While standard double glazing is frequently too thick, professionals can use slim-profile units or vacuum glass that fits within the existing timber refunds of the majority of sash and casement windows. Nevertheless, this usually needs planning consent for noted structures.
How frequently do brought back historic windows require maintenance?
If an expert uses top quality oils, resins, and paints, the lumber ought to be examined every 5 to 7 years. Due to the fact that historical windows are created to be dismantled and repaired, they can last forever if the paint movie is preserved.
Is it less expensive to fix or change?
Preliminary repair costs can often be equivalent to the expense of a high-end bespoke replacement. However, repair work is usually more affordable than a like-for-like top quality replacement and carries the included advantage of maintaining the structure's historic stability and preventing planning problems.
Why not simply utilize uPVC "heritage" windows?
Even high-quality uPVC heritage windows have various reflective qualities and thicker frame profiles than initial lumber. In addition, uPVC is a "disposable" material; once the seal fails or the frame breaks down, the entire unit should be changed. Lumber windows are "repairable" units.
What is the main reason for window failure?
Paint failure is the most common cause. When paint cracks, moisture gets in the lumber and ends up being trapped, resulting in fungal rot. Proper preparation and the use of microporous paints by specialists prevent this cycle.
